Alleged Burglar Fatally Shot In Lynwood Home

LYNWOOD (CBS) — A coroner's official Tuesday said an 18-year-old man was fatally shot in a Lynwood home.

Assistant Chief Ed Winter of the coroner's office said a preliminary investigation revealed that the young man was allegedly burglarizing the home when he was shot by a resident.

The shooting took place at the home in the 11000 block of Harris Avenue near Elmwood Avenue about 10 p.m. Monday, Deputy Benjamin Grubb of Sheriff's Headquarters Bureau said.

The teen died at the scene. His name has been withheld.
